find the vertex of y=x^2-6x+1 A. ( 1 , 5 ) B. ( 4 , 1 ) C. ( 2 , -3 ) D. ( 3 , -8)

Respuesta :

chikafujiwara
chikafujiwara chikafujiwara
  • 01-09-2020

[tex]h=\frac{-b}{2a}[/tex]

[tex]k=f(h)[/tex]

[tex]h=\frac{6}{2}[/tex]

[tex]h=3[/tex]

[tex]k=f(3)[/tex]

[tex]f(3)=9-18+1[/tex]

[tex]f(3)=-8[/tex]

The vertex is [tex](3,-8)[/tex]
